What Are Eco-Friendly Packaging Options?

Eco-friendly packaging refers to materials and designs that reduce environmental impact and carbon footprint. These options include biodegradable materials, recyclable packaging, and reusable containers. These alternatives not only contribute to a healthier planet but also align with consumer preferences for sustainability. Businesses are increasingly adopting these options to meet regulatory demands and customer expectations.

Why Should Businesses Consider Eco-Friendly Packaging?

Companies have multiple reasons for transitioning to eco-friendly packaging. It enhances brand reputation and demonstrates corporate responsibility. Consumers are more inclined to purchase from brands committed to sustainability. Additionally, using eco-friendly materials can often lead to cost savings in the long run, as many biodegradable and recyclable options are becoming more affordable.

What Types of Materials Are Considered Eco-Friendly?

Several materials are recognized as eco-friendly, including:- **Bioplastics**: Made from renewable resources like corn starch, these plastics break down more easily than traditional plastics.- **Recycled Paper Products**: These are made from post-consumer waste, reducing the need for virgin material and conserving resources.- **Glass**: Completely recyclable, glass can be reused and recycled multiple times without losing quality.- **Plant-Based Materials**: Materials derived from plants, like cardboard and hemp, provide eco-friendly alternatives that can reduce dependence on plastic.

Are Eco-Friendly Packaging Solutions More Expensive?

While some eco-friendly options may initially appear more expensive, the long-term benefits often outweigh these costs. Increased consumer demand for sustainable products can lead to higher sales, potentially offsetting the initial investment. Many manufacturers also produce eco-friendly products at scale, leading to reduced costs over time.

Can Eco-Friendly Packaging Maintain Product Freshness?

Yes, many eco-friendly options can effectively maintain product freshness. Advances in technology have led to the development of biodegradable materials that meet similar performance standards as traditional packaging. These materials often incorporate features like moisture barriers and oxygen impermeability, ensuring that products remain fresh and safe for consumption.

How Can Consumers Identify Eco-Friendly Packaging?

Consumers can look for specific certifications and labels that indicate eco-friendliness, such as:- **FSC Certification**: Indicates that the wood or paper used comes from sustainable forests.- **Recyclable Symbols**: These guide consumers in how to dispose of the packaging responsibly.- **Biodegradable Labels**: Products marked as biodegradable will break down naturally over time.Additionally, packaging transparency is key; companies should disclose their materials and sustainability practices.

What Challenges Do Companies Face When Switching to Eco-Friendly Packaging?

Transitioning to eco-friendly packaging can present challenges. These include higher upfront costs, limited supplier options, and the need for consumer education. Companies must be diligent in researching suppliers and may need to invest in consumer awareness campaigns to inform customers about the benefits of their new packaging.

Are There Government Regulations Regarding Packaging Sustainability?

Many governments are implementing stricter regulations concerning packaging waste and sustainability. Businesses may face penalties for non-compliance or gain tax incentives for adopting eco-friendly practices. Staying informed about local, national, and international regulations is crucial for companies aiming to remain compliant and competitive.

How Does Eco-Friendly Packaging Impact Shipping and Logistics?

Eco-friendly packaging can significantly impact shipping and logistics. Lighter materials can reduce shipping costs and emissions, while durable packaging minimizes product damage during transit. Companies must plan carefully to balance sustainability with efficiency, ensuring that eco-friendly solutions align with their overall logistics strategy.

How Can Companies Start Transitioning to Eco-Friendly Packaging?

To begin the transition, companies should conduct an audit of their current packaging, evaluate supplier options, and invest in research and development. Employee training on sustainability practices and consumer engagement strategies can also enhance the transition.
